Overview
A leading utility provider operating across electricity, water, and gas distribution in South Asia faced growing pressure to modernize its operational intelligence systems. With over 40 million customers and infrastructure spanning thousands of kilometres, the organization struggled to manage real-time data, optimize field operations, and respond proactively to outages and inefficiencies.
Client Background and Challenges
The client’s legacy systems were siloed, reactive, and heavily reliant on manual reporting. Operational decisions were often delayed due to fragmented data sources, lack of predictive insights, and limited visibility into asset performance. As regulatory mandates tightened and customer expectations rose, the need for a unified, intelligent dashboard system became urgent.
- Fragmented Data Ecosystem: operational data was scattered across SCADA systems, ERP platforms, field service logs, and IoT sensors — making a unified view of performance difficult.
- Reactive Decision-Making: outages, leakages, and service disruptions were addressed after customer complaints, rather than through predictive alerts or automated workflows.
- Limited Field Visibility: supervisors lacked real-time insight into field-crew locations, task progress, and asset conditions — leading to inefficiencies and delays.
